免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
12345
最近访问板块 发新帖
楼主: mygod
打印 上一主题 下一主题

[讨论]大家来讨论一下开发流程问题 [复制链接]

论坛徽章:
0
41 [报告]
发表于 2002-12-20 23:44 |只看该作者

[讨论]大家来讨论一下开发流程问题

下面引用由minghui2002/12/20 03:58pm 发表的内容:
对JSP Model 2工作流程的一些体会
由于我们使用JSP Model 2的框架结构,而各种servlet在JSP Model 2的MVC结构中扮演C(ontroller)的角色,所以我们使用如下步骤完成一次典型的JSP Model 2调用过程:
1. 在servlet ...

贴一张图(取自 IBM 的 Web application design with servlets and JSPs):




论坛徽章:
0
42 [报告]
发表于 2002-12-23 14:32 |只看该作者

[讨论]大家来讨论一下开发流程问题

ok

论坛徽章:
0
43 [报告]
发表于 2002-12-24 00:14 |只看该作者

[讨论]大家来讨论一下开发流程问题

    我也来掺乎一下。事先声明:我不是标准程序员,虽然我也写过程序,参与过项目。
   
    我的感觉是这样:
    在中国国内的软件项目中,项目需求本身就存在问题。
    [首先],如果一个市场部门的人去客户那里做需求,可以想象,和合同一起回来的是什么?
    [其次],即便是有了软件工程师参与的项目需求,也多数因为自己的沟通能力、表达能力差强人意,而导致项目需求做的不到位,甚至反复多次。客户的想法没有固定模式,可能想什么是什么,想到哪里就说到哪里,这样的结果又是什么?很明显,客户的需求无止境,项目需求书越写越多。
    [还有]另外一种现象,PM本身的实力较弱,不明白客户和软件工程师共同的重要性,在这两者之间很难起到桥梁的作用,导致供需脱节。更有甚者,把自己的需求当作客户的需求,提交给软件工程师,再把结果反馈给客户,极大的延长了软件开发周期,此种类型的人,一定要下岗(有感而发,请大家别介意)。
    其实,我说了半天,主要就是想说,我们参与项目也好,管理项目也好,项目管理中的知识,要多加运用,不光是PM要运用项目管理技能来协调、组织好项目,参与者同样需要项目管理中的学到的知识来和PM、客户沟通。这样,项目才有可能按照既定的目标来前进。

    我说的可能跑题了,没有针对大家所说的开发模式来探讨问题。但是,我认为,项目的主导是人,不是方法。开发模式也不过是人来定义的游戏规则,什么样的项目,什么样的人,适合什么开发方法,没有定式,是作为软件开发者需要更好的交流的东西,是经验的结果。每种开发方法都有自己的特点,适合各自类型的项目。但是,人的项目管理不好的话,什么都白费了。

    说得不当之处,请大家批评指正。谢谢!

--呵呵,白话完毕,大家不要拿烂柿子砸偶啊,:)

论坛徽章:
0
44 [报告]
发表于 2002-12-24 08:24 |只看该作者

[讨论]大家来讨论一下开发流程问题

认同,并深受其害!!!
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P